Evaluation on mean performance of yield and its attributing characters in germplasm of fennel (Foeniculum vulgare Mill.)

Abstract

The present study was conducted at the College of Horticulture and Forestry, Acharya Narendra Deva University of Agriculture & Technology, Kumarganj, Ayodhya during the rabi season of 2022-23. Plant material consisted of 57 genotypes of fennel including 2 check varieties NDF-1 (A.N.D.U.A.T, Kumarganj, Ayodhya) and RF-101 (SKNAU, Jobner, Rajasthan). The experiment was conducted in Augmented Block Design of 2x1.2m2 plot size with 40x60cm2 spacing. The assessment covered various characteristics related to both crop productivity and quality. Among the test entries, the wide variations in mean performance of the genotypes were observed for all the characters. Based on mean performance, most of the genotypes were found superior than its best checks for different traits. But some genotype viz., NDF-2 (63.83 g) followed by NDF-46 (56.22 g), NDF-24 (55.65 g), NDF-12 (55.33 g), NDF-9 (55.01g) and other 11 more genotypes were found significantly superior over checks for seed yield per plant along with some other characters.
